Ranchi, Feb. 16 -- Jharkhand has recorded an increase of Rs 34,381.75 crore in total deposits year on year and the State has also recorded an increase of Rs21,229.68 crore in total loans year on year. The State is continuously increasing the credit deposit ratio. While the credit deposit ratio was 44.44 per cent compared to last year, this year it increased to 46.27 per cent. The year on year increase was 4.12 per cent.

These things came to light during the 86th meeting of the State Level Bankers Committee (SLBC) held on Thursday in Ranchi.
